Abstract

The atmospheric-electric processes can be understood only if it is assumed that the atmosphere is electrically conducting. The presence of aerosols in the air was found to be greatly affecting the air ion concentration. At rural station Ramanandnagar, there are numbers of sources for the production of air ions, at the same time there are limited sources for the production of aerosol in the atmosphere. Variations of air ions in atmospheric air have been investigated using Gerdien type air ion counter. This air ion counter indigenously designed and developed at the Indian Institute of Tropical Meteorology Pune and operated at rural site Ramanandnagar. During the morning period average positive air ions were 9x10 2 ions per cm 3 in January 2012, they start decreasing and reaches to minimum (1.2 x10 2 ions per cm 3 ) in April. Average negative air ions were 6x10 2 ions per cm 3 in January during the morning period (06:00-08:00 hours). During evening period average positive air ions were 11x10 2 ions per cm 3 in January 2012, starts decreasing and reaches to minimum (1.8 x10 2 ions per cm 3 ) in April. Pollution index above 1.2 in January, May and August 2012 during evening period (18:00-20:00 hours), which is harmful to the human health. KeywordsAir Pollution; Air Quality; Aerosol; Transperation
